Output 873314957224506b328c21b4fe384bbd21042a0b2baae26a064803319be3501a:13

value
503007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e9d18f5e2b6d79f766607a4a149fbd2eddee52e OP_EQUAL
address
38rgpqEAvshoa1tLufX4qoAoNCq3dY2GvB
transaction
873314957224506b328c21b4fe384bbd21042a0b2baae26a064803319be3501a
confirmations
258611
spent
true